Kako instalirati Javu na Linux korak po korak

Zadnje ažuriranje: 25/06/2025
Autor: Isaac
  • Java se može lako instalirati na različite distribucije Linux pomoću vašeg upravitelja paketa.
  • Postoje različite verzije Jave: JRE za pokretanje aplikacija i JDK za njihov razvoj.
  • Ubuntu, Debian, Fedora i Arch Linux imaju specifične metode za instaliranje Jave.
  • Bitno je ispravno konfigurirati JAVA_HOME i provjeriti instalaciju nakon završetka.

Java Linux

Instaliranje Jave na Linux može se činiti kompliciranim ako vam je prvi put, ali istina je da je, uz prave korake, to brz i jednostavan proces. Bez obzira trebate li Javu za pokretanje aplikacija ili planirate razvoj softvera, njezina pravilna instalacija i konfiguracija na vašem Linux sustavu ključna je za izbjegavanje pogrešaka i optimizaciju performansi.

U ovom ažuriranom i detaljnom vodiču objašnjavamo Kako instalirati Javu na Linux korak po korak, koji pokriva najčešće distribucije poput Ubuntua, Debiana, Fedore i Arch Linuxa. Također vas učimo kako birati između JRE-a i JDK-a, konfigurirati varijable okruženja kao što su JAVA_HOME i odaberite zadanu verziju ako ih imate instalirano nekoliko.

Što je Java i zašto vam je potrebna na Linuxu?

Java je jezik za programiranje objektno orijentirana široko korišten zbog svoje mogućnosti rada na više platformi. Zahvaljujući Java virtualni stroj (JVM), aplikacije razvijene u ovom jeziku mogu se pokretati na gotovo svakom operativnom sustavu, uključujući Linux.

To je neophodno za programe poput Apache Tomcat, Jenkins, Minecraft, Kasandra, Mol i mnogi drugi. Bez obzira pokrećete li ili razvijate ove aplikacije, morate instalirati Javu na svoju Linux distribuciju.

Vrste paketa: JRE i JDK

Prije instaliranja Jave, važno je znati da postoje dvije glavne opcije:

  • JRE (Java Runtime Environment): Sadrži sve što je potrebno za pokretanje Java aplikacija, ali ne uključuje razvojne alate poput kompajlera.
  • JDK (Java Development Kit): Uz JRE, ove verzije uključuju sve što je potrebno za kompajliranje, otklanjanje pogrešaka i razvoj Java softvera.

Ako ćete samo pokretati programe, JRE je dovoljan. Ali ako ćete pisati Java kod, trebat će vam JDK.

  Kako spremiti e-poštu na PC

Instaliranje Jave na Ubuntu i Debian

Ove dvije distribucije dijele sustav paketa APT, što olakšava instalaciju.

Ažuriranje repozitorija

Započnite s pokretanjem ovih naredbe u terminal Kako biste bili sigurni da imate najnovije verzije:

sudo apt update
sudo apt upgrade

Instalirajte zadani JRE

Za instalaciju osnovnog okruženja za izvođenje:

sudo apt install default-jre

Instalirajte zadani JDK

Ako ćete razvijati programe u Javi:

sudo apt install default-jdk

Instalirajte određenu verziju OpenJDK-a

Za pregled dostupnih verzija:

apt search openjdk

Zatim možete instalirati, na primjer, Javu 11 pomoću:

sudo apt install openjdk-11-jdk

Instaliranje Oracle JDK-a

Oracle Java nudi proširenu podršku i potreban je za neke komercijalne aplikacije. Da biste ga instalirali, morate to učiniti ručno:

    1. Preuzmite datoteku .tar.gz sa službene Oracleove web stranice.
    2. Prenesite ga na svoj poslužitelj pomoću scp ili klijent poput FileZille:
scp jdk-version_linux-x64_bin.tar.gz usuario@IP:/tmp
    1. Ekstrahirajte datoteku:
tar -xzf jdk-version_linux-x64_bin.tar.gz
    1. Premjestite JDK mapu na trajnu lokaciju:
sudo mv jdk-version /usr/lib/jvm/oracle-jdk-version

Instalirajte Javu na Fedoru

U Fedori se upravitelj koristi DNFZa instalaciju Jave 17, trenutno se preporučuje:

sudo dnf install java-17-openjdk

Za JDK:

sudo dnf install java-17-openjdk-devel

Instaliranje Jave na Arch Linuxu

Arch Linux olakšava instalaciju različitih verzija Jave iz svojih repozitorija:

Za JRE:

sudo pacman -S jre-openjdk

Za JDK:

sudo pacman -S jdk-openjdk

Provjerite instalaciju

Nakon instalacije Jave, provjerite radi li:

Za pregled Jave verzije:

java -version

Za pregled verzije Java kompajlera:

javac -version

Ako vidite nešto slično Verzija openjdk-a «17.0.2», sve je točno.

Odabir verzije Jave koja će se koristiti prema zadanim postavkama

Na sustavima s više verzija možete odabrati zadanu postavku pomoću:

sudo update-alternatives --config java

To možete učiniti i s drugim naredbama kao što su javac, javadoc, keytool, Itd

Konfiguriraj JAVA_HOME

Mnogi alati poput Mavena zahtijevaju da imate definiranu varijablu JAVA_HOME.

  Kako nazvati Judy u Cyberpunku 2077 i otključati njezinu priču

Pronađite put instalacije

Provjerite gdje je Java instalirana pomoću:

sudo update-alternatives --config java

Vidjet ćete rute poput /usr/lib/jvm/java-17-openjdk-amd64.

Postavljanje JAVA_HOME za korisnika

Uredite svoju datoteku .bashrc:

nano ~/.bashrc

Na kraju dodaje:

export JAVA_HOME=/usr/lib/jvm/java-17-openjdk-amd64
export PATH=$JAVA_HOME/bin:$PATH

Spremite i primijenite promjene:

source ~/.bashrc

Postavi JAVA_HOME na razini cijelog sustava

sudo nano /etc/environment

Dodajte ovaj redak (prilagođava putanju):

JAVA_HOME="/usr/lib/jvm/java-17-openjdk-amd64"

Primijeni promjene:

source /etc/environment

Kako ukloniti ili ažurirati Javu

Za ažuriranje Jave:

sudo apt update && sudo apt upgrade

Za uklanjanje određene instalacije:

sudo apt remove openjdk-17-jdk

A ako želite izbrisati i postavke:

sudo apt purge openjdk-17-jdk

Instaliranje Jave na Linux nije kompliciran zadatak, ali važno je razumjeti korake i razlike između verzija. U ovom članku prikupili smo sve relevantne informacije kako biste mogli jednostavno instalirati Javu na Debian, Ubuntu, Fedora i Arch Linux. Također ćemo vam pokazati kako pravilno konfigurirati varijablu JAVA_HOME i odabrati verziju koju želite kao zadanu. S time ste spremni pokrenuti ili razviti bilo koju Java aplikaciju na svom Linux sustavu.

koju-verziju-jave-imam?
Povezani članak:
Ne znate koju verziju Jave imate? Ovdje saznajte koji je